1. Can a NRI buy property in India without physical presence
If an NRI is buying or selling property in India, both the buyer and seller usually need to be physically present to complete the registration process, as per the Registration Act of 1908. However, if the NRI can't be there, they can appoint a trusted person as a Power of Attorney (POA) to sign the documents on their behalf.
2. How NRI can purchase property in India
An NRI (Non-Resident Indian) doesn't need special permission from the RBI (Reserve Bank of India) to buy property in India, whether it's residential or commercial. So basically, NRIs can freely purchase immovable properties in India without any hassle.
